Experts at Tacomaprobono’s Housing Justice Project and Pierce County Human Services will answer legal questions and provide help applying for rental/utility assistance programs.

Do you have questions about the Eviction Moratorium Bridge ending? Do you need help with past due rent or utilities because of COVID-19? This drop-in Housing Help clinic is designed for you.

Talk with staff from Tacomaprobono and Pierce County Human Services to get answers to your basic questions about eviction prevention related to COVID-19, legal protections for tenants, the Eviction Moratorium, and the Eviction Resolution Program, or apply for rental/utility assistance on-site. Tacomaprobono will also be able help determine if you’re eligible for 1:1 assistance through their legal clinics, and complete that intake process.
